  • Have any of you used Syrinscape sound effects / music for CoS?
    It only does ambiences, not soundboard-type effects, but a great free alternative is ambient-mixer.com, they have tons of stock sounds to choose from or you can upload your own sounds, and you can mix up to 8 channels with volume and pan control, continuous looping or staggered timing per minute, 10 mins, or hour. You can also save and share your ambiences or listen to tons of others created by other users. Source: over 2 years ago
